Maryland License Plates Hijacked as Mobile Ads for Filipino Gambling Site

Marylanders unwittingly showcase online casino ads on license plates meant to commemorate historic event.

In an unexpected twist, Maryland’s commemorative license plates have been turned into moving billboards for an online casino in the Philippines. What was intended as a symbol of historical remembrance has now become an inadvertent advertisement, catching residents by surprise as they navigate the streets.

Back in 2007, the license plates were introduced to honor the War of 1812 bicentennial. The design aimed to raise funds for bicentennial projects through Star-Spangled 200, Inc., a nonprofit organization affiliated with the War of 1812 Bicentennial Commission, as confirmed by the Maryland Motor Vehicle Administration.

However, a keen-eyed Redditor recently discovered that the URL displayed on the bottom of these license plates did not lead to the intended Star-Spangled 200, Inc. or provide information about the historic event. Instead, it redirected curious onlookers to a website promoting the “Philippines Best Betting Site.”

With approximately 798,000 active War of 1812 license plates currently adorning vehicles throughout the state, according to the Maryland Motor Vehicle Administration, hundreds of thousands of Marylanders may unknowingly be driving around with their license plates unwittingly promoting online gambling.
